For content creators, photographers, musicians, and video editors, duplicate files are an absolute nightmare. When you are working on a project, you might create dozens of versions of the same file. If you do not manage these duplicates properly, they can quickly consume hundreds of gigabytes of storage. Duplicate file removers that include photo similarity detection are particularly valuable for photographers and content creators, as they can help organize nearly identical images that would otherwise require manual sorting. This frees up space for new creative projects and ensures that your working directories remain clean and efficient.
